US insurers increase reserves by $22.1bn
A study by Weiss Ratings has found that in 2002 US property/casualty insurers increased reserves for prior-year paid and unpaid
claims by $22.1bn, compared to $11.7bn in 2001. Weiss said that this increase in reserves is the largest by the US property/casualty
industry since Weiss began its analysis over 10 years ago.
